First, Pentecost (aka Shavuot or the Feast of Weeks) is one of the 3 annual pilgrimage festivals of the Jewish year. Observance of Shavuot is included in the festival calendars in the Torah. Every adult Jew was expected to travel to Jerusalem on each of these festivals. The story of Pentecost in Acts occurs as the disciples are taking part in this pilgrimage, so they were already celebrating it before the events remembered in Acts. You could say it's worth celebrating because it's commanded to celebrate it, or you could say that it's worth celebrating because of the impact it had on the early Church, changing the mission from preaching only to the Jewish community to preaching to the whole world.

What is Whitsunday?

Whitsunday is the same as Pentecost, the seventh Sunday after Easter. It is a Christian festival celebrating the descent of the Holy Spirit upon the apostles.

What is the significance of the pentecost?

Pentecost commemorates the day that the Holy Spirit descended upon the Apostles, prompting them to begin evangelizing. It is the birthday of the Church. Had Pentecost never occurred, there would be no Christian Church today.
